STATE LEVEL SLOGAN COMPETITION FOR STUDENTS

2654

Panaji:  July 11, 2015 …. On the day of Child Labour the Goa State Commission for Protection of Child Right (GSCPCR) is organizing a state level slogan competition for students from 5th to 10th standard. The theme for the competition is “We are happy children are not employed here”.

Participants can send the slogan in any of the 4 languages (English/Marathi/Hindi/Konkani) by post, along with name, age, residential address, name of school , class, telephone number to Goa State Commission for Protection of Child Rights, XA-8, 3rd floor, Sakhardande Apartment, Dr. Dada Vaidya Road, Panaji.

Each language category will get a prize of Rs. 500 along with a certificate. The entries should reach the office by August 6, 2015.
